.photo-showcase-ctn{text-align:center}.photo-showcase-ctn .photo-showcase-title{font-size:36px;line-height:100%;margin:0 0 40px}.photo-showcase-ctn .photo-showcase-grid{list-style:none;display:grid;grid-template-columns:repeat(4,1fr);gap:40px 20px;margin:0;padding:0}.photo-showcase-ctn .photo-showcase-item{position:relative;overflow:hidden;max-height:270px;opacity:1;pointer-events:auto;transition:max-height .5s ease,opacity .5s ease,transform .5s ease}.photo-showcase-ctn .photo-showcase-item.is-collapsed{max-height:0;opacity:0;margin:0;padding:0;pointer-events:none;border:0}.photo-showcase-ctn .photo-showcase-item a{display:block;width:100%;aspect-ratio:344 / 270;position:relative;overflow:hidden;border:1px solid rgba(0,0,0,.1)}.photo-showcase-ctn .photo-showcase-item a img{position:absolute;top:50%;left:50%;width:100%!important;height:100%;object-fit:cover;transform:translate(-50%,-50%)}.photo-showcase-ctn .show-more-container{margin:auto;max-width:280px;height:58px;background:#31333d;color:#fff;font-size:16px;line-height:58px;text-align:center}.photo-showcase-ctn .show-more-button{all:unset;cursor:pointer;display:block;text-align:center;width:100%;height:100%;font-size:16px;transition:background-color .3s ease}.photo-showcase-ctn .show-more-button:hover{background-color:#444652}@media only screen and (max-width: 1200px){.photo-showcase-ctn .photo-showcase-grid{grid-template-columns:repeat(2,1fr);gap:20px 16px}}@media only screen and (max-width: 768px){.photo-showcase-ctn .photo-showcase-title{font-size:24px;margin:0 0 20px}.photo-showcase-ctn .show-more-container{max-width:168px;height:40px;margin-top:20px;line-height:40px}}
/*# sourceMappingURL=/cdn/shop/t/9/assets/coring-photo-showcase-style.css.map */
